Description:

The Innovation Platform – INNOVINE & WINE (NORTE-01-0145-FEDER-000038) is a multidisciplinary project that seeks to involve researchers in the areas of soil, climatology and climate change, ecology, viticulture, physiology, microbiology, oenology, engineering and economics. The research strengths of the University of Trás-os-Montes and Alto Douro and innovation competencies aim to establish strong and productive relationships with global R & D performance organizations that share similar research interests.

The platform integrates four main lines of research:
(i) the study of interactions between soil and climatic conditions and vines at the vineyard scale;
(ii) the implementation of climate change adaptation strategies for wine-growing regions;
(iii) the development and optimization of oenological practices that promote the sustainable production of wines of highly differentiated quality, oriented to the market of denomination of origin;
(iv) study of the competitiveness of the sector through investigation of the vineyard, market and consumer systems, international trade and territorial base activities associated with vine and wine, such as wine tourism and gastronomy.

With these objectives the platform aims to:

  • Achieve economies of scale;
  • To obtain relevant scientific and technological results for the sector;
  • Promoting the production of wine, economically and environmentally more sustainable;
  • Encourage the inclusion of stakeholders in the decision-making process to encourage the development of applied science and increase the impact of the platform’s activities;
  • To boost the incorporation of high levels of knowledge and innovation in the wine industry.
